pantsaholic was correct.

12.5 goes for pokes like eevee where there are 12.5% female and 86.5% male.
25 goes for those like growlithe who are 25% female, 75% male.
75 is for those like clefairy who are 75% female, 25% male.

Starting frames:

If a Pokemon is NOT listed here, assume it has a starting frame of 1.

Raikou: 1
Entei: 6 (unless Raikou has been caught, then it's 1)
Note: It has been reported that in European versions Entei is 1 and Raikou is 6.

Sometimes this happens, no one really knows why as far as I know. Don't worry about KOing Entei or anything, just use elm calls. Sometimes they can be shifted a few frames, like the game is advancing frames for no reason, so they may not match up using the RNG Reporter's feature but you can usually find the correct pattern somewhere in the adjacent delays.
